The upper trim level trucks like Cheyenne and Silverado had the rear interior panels. They are very hard to find in decent condition because they are easily damaged by moisture. You can make your own out of about anything, ABS plastic, aluminum sheet, plywood, etc. Then cover them with vinyl or something. It also helps having carpet with padding under it.
